Angela Rayner relaxed property rules to simplify efforts to construct houses on gardens. The government announced the decision alongside a £10bn residential funding package.

This funding serves as the starting step of a major housing investment program intended to supply new homes across chosen locations.

Opponents labeled the policy changes a return to garden grabbing. James Cleverly said the National Planning Policy Framework overhaul signals a return to garden grabbing. The Telegraph described the step as a hopeless solution to Britain's housing crisis, while the government concentrates on rolling out the new funding.
